Popular Courses

Brand
Awarding body image

Overview of Introduction to Coding With HTML, CSS, & Javascript

Ever looked at a website and wondered, “How is this actually built?” If so, you’re in the right place. Therefore, this online coding course for beginners gives you a friendly introduction to coding, so you can learn coding online without feeling overwhelmed. From the start, you’ll work with HTML, CSS, JavaScript to understand how web pages are created, styled, and brought to life.

Moreover, these skills are used almost everywhere on the web, so your learning stays highly relevant. For example, JavaScript is used by about 98.8% of websites, while CSS is used by about 96.6%—which shows why HTML CSS JavaScript is such a strong foundation for web development. In addition, developer surveys consistently rank JavaScript and HTML/CSS among the most used technologies, so you’re learning what real web developers rely on.

Finally, this web development course online UK is designed to be practical, not theoretical. Therefore, you’ll learn to code from scratch, then apply it to responsive web design, DOM manipulation, and form validation so your pages look good and work properly. As a result, you’ll complete hands-on web development projects and a portfolio project, which can support your next step—whether that’s Advanced Diploma in PHP Web or Coding (HTML, C++, Python, JavaScript & IT) to get a job.

Exclusive Course Glimpse

What You Will Learn in Introduction to Coding With HTML, CSS, & Javascript

This coding for beginners online course covers the essentials of web development in a clear order. Moreover, it helps you build strong foundations before moving to more advanced skills.

By the end of this web development course, you will learn:

  • Web Development Basics Course: Understand how websites and web pages work
  • HTML and CSS Course for Beginners: Build structure and styling for clean layouts
  • JavaScript for Beginners Course: Add interactive behaviour to web pages
  • Build a Website From Scratch: Create pages that look professional and work smoothly
  • Responsive Web Design: Make web pages adapt to different screen sizes
  • DOM Manipulation: Control and update web content using JavaScript
  • Form Validation: Build safer, user-friendly forms and input checks
  • Developer Tools / IDEs / Online Editors: Use beginner-friendly tools like code editors and online editors
  • Hands-On Web Development Projects: Practise skills with guided tasks
  • Portfolio Project Web Development Course Outcome: Finish with a project you can show employers

As a result, you gain skills that feel practical immediately, while also building confidence for your next step in coding.

Why Choose Us?​

There are many coding courses available. However, this online web development course for beginners is designed to be simple, structured, and practical. Moreover, it supports both learners who want a hobby skill and learners who want a career path as a front-end developer, or even later as a full-stack developer.

In addition, the course includes:

  • Affordable Learning: Structured lessons for smooth progress
  • CPD-Certified: Strengthen your CV with recognised credentials
  • Lifetime Access: Learn anytime at your own pace
  • Instant Certificate: Receive certification upon completion
  • Flexible Scheduling: Study around your work or studies
  • Transparent Pricing: No hidden costs
  • Quick Assessments: Monitor your progress easily
  • 24/7 Support: Assistance via chat or email

Therefore, if you want a beginner-friendly course that teaches real web development skills, this is a strong place to start.

Certificate of Achievement

After completing this HTML CSS JavaScript course, you will receive a CPD-accredited certificate to confirm your learning professionally. Moreover, a certificate helps you show commitment when applying for junior roles or freelance work.

You can typically choose:

  • PDF Certificate – £4.99
  • Hardcopy Certificate – £9.99

In addition, a certificate can help you:

  • Strengthen your CV and LinkedIn profile
  • Show proof of structured learning
  • Support junior web or IT job applications

Build credibility for freelance website work

Nextgen Certificate

Who Is This Course For?​

This introduction to coding course is suitable for:

  • Beginners who want to learn coding online step by step
  • People who want an HTML and CSS course for beginners
  • Learners aiming for a web developer course for beginners
  • Small business owners who want to build or edit websites
  • Students exploring computer programming and tech careers
  • People interested in becoming a front-end developer
  • Anyone who wants to build a website from scratch course experience

Although experience can help, you do not need prior coding knowledge to start.

Introduction to Coding With HTML, CSS, & Javascript

Requirements​

There are no formal entry requirements for this coding for beginners course. However, to learn comfortably, you should have:

  • Basic English reading skills
  • A laptop, tablet, or smartphone
  • A stable internet connection

Because this is a self-paced coding course online, you can study at your own speed. Therefore, you can pause, repeat lessons, and practise whenever you have time.

Career Path of Introduction to Coding With HTML, CSS, & Javascript

Career Path of Introduction to Coding With HTML, CSS, & Javascript

After completing this web development course online UK, you may be ready to explore beginner-friendly career paths. Moreover, your portfolio project can help you prove skills even without job experience.

Common career directions include:

Junior Web Developer (Entry Level) – £22,000 to £35,000 annually (UK)
Support websites, update pages, and fix layout issues. Moreover, HTML, CSS, and JavaScript skills are essential for this role.

Front-End Developer (Junior) – £25,000 to £45,000 annually (UK)
Build user-facing web pages and responsive layouts. Therefore, knowledge of responsive web design and DOM manipulation is highly valuable.

Web Content / Website Assistant – £20,000 to £30,000 annually (UK)
Maintain website pages, upload content, and improve page layouts. In addition, basic coding helps you work faster without relying on developers.

Freelance Website Builder – Variable Income (UK)
Build simple websites for clients or small businesses. As a result, you can turn your build a website from scratch skills into side income.

Salary figures are indicative and vary by region, industry, and experience.

Order Your Certificate

To order your Certificate, we kindly invite you to visit the following link

FAQs About Introduction to Coding With HTML, CSS, & Javascript

Yes, this is designed for complete beginners. Therefore, you can start with an introduction to coding and build confidence step by step. Moreover, lessons stay simple and practical.

Yes, you will learn HTML, CSS, and JavaScript in a structured order. First, you build page structure with HTML, then style with CSS, and then add interaction with JavaScript. As a result, learning feels smoother.

Yes, the course includes guided practice and project-based learning. Therefore, you will learn to code from scratch and build real web pages. In addition, this supports your portfolio.

Yes, this is a strong starting point for a web developer course for beginners. Therefore, you can progress into front-end development and later explore back-end or full-stack learning. However, consistent practice is key.

Yes, a certificate can strengthen your CV and LinkedIn profile. Moreover, it shows you completed structured learning in web development basics. However, pairing it with a portfolio project is even stronger.

Course Curriculum

Getting Started
Introduction 00:03:00
Course Curriculum 00:05:00
How to Get Course requirements 00:02:00
Getting Started on Windows, Linux or Mac 00:02:00
How to ask a Great Questions 00:01:00
FAQ’s 00:01:00
Setting up Development Environment
Introduction 00:05:00
Choosing Code Editor 00:06:00
Installing Code Editor(Sublime Text) 00:04:00
Overview of a Webpage 00:05:00
Full HTML Code Page 00:07:00
First “Hello World!” page 00:09:00
Summary 00:02:00
HTML Fundamentals
Introduction 00:03:00
Heading 00:09:00
Paragraph 00:08:00
Formatting text 00:12:00
List Items Un Ordered 00:05:00
List Items Ordered 00:04:00
Classes 00:09:00
ID’s in CSS 00:06:00
Comments in HTML 00:04:00
Summary 00:04:00
HTML Intermediate
Introduction 00:02:00
Images 00:12:00
Forms 00:05:00
Form Actions 00:04:00
Br tag 00:03:00
Marquee 00:06:00
Text area 00:06:00
Tables 00:06:00
Links 00:07:00
Navbar / Menu 00:04:00
HTML Entities 00:05:00
Div tag 00:06:00
Google Maps 00:07:00
Summary 00:02:00
HTML Advanced
Introduction 00:02:00
HTML5 Audio 00:07:00
HTML5 Video 00:05:00
Progress Bar 00:04:00
Drag & Drop 00:18:00
Canvas 00:06:00
I frames 00:05:00
Input Types 00:04:00
Input Attributes 00:06:00
YouTube Video Linking 00:04:00
Creating Responsive Page 00:05:00
Summary 00:02:00
HTML Expert
Introduction 00:02:00
Registration Form 00:04:00
Login Form 00:04:00
About Us Form 00:02:00
Contact Us Form 00:10:00
Footer Form 00:03:00
Integrate All Together 00:07:00
Coding Exercise 00:01:00
Solution for Coding Exercise 00:02:00
Summary 00:02:00
HTML Website Project
Introduction 00:02:00
Challenge – HTML 5 Clock Face with Numbers 00:05:00
Project Overview 00:03:00
Conclusion on Project 00:01:00
Summary 00:02:00
CSS Fundamentals
Introduction 00:03:00
CSS Syntax 00:05:00
Creating webpage with CSS 00:13:00
Inline CSS 00:06:00
Internal CSS 00:05:00
External CSS 00:10:00
CSS Classes 00:09:00
CSS IDs 00:06:00
Colors 00:08:00
Backgrounds 00:04:00
Floating 00:09:00
Positioning 00:06:00
Margins 00:07:00
Padding 00:04:00
Borders 00:03:00
Summary 00:02:00
CSS Intermediate
Introduction 00:02:00
Styling Text 00:07:00
Aligning Text 00:04:00
Styling Links 00:10:00
Font Family 00:07:00
Font Styles 00:03:00
Applying Google Fonts 00:07:00
Box Model 00:09:00
Icons 00:09:00
Tables 00:16:00
Navigation-Menu 00:11:00
Dropdowns 00:15:00
Summary 00:02:00
CSS Advanced
Introduction 00:02:00
Advanced Selectors 00:05:00
Forms 00:17:00
Website Layout 00:21:00
Rounded Corners 00:08:00
Color Keywords 00:06:00
Animations 00:08:00
Pseudo Classes 00:03:00
Gradients 00:03:00
Shadows 00:03:00
Calculations 00:05:00
Creating Responsive Page 00:06:00
Summary 00:02:00
CSS Expert
Introduction 00:01:00
Button Styles 00:06:00
Flexbox 00:14:00
CSS Grid 00:15:00
Pagination 00:07:00
Multiple Columns 00:06:00
Image Reflection 00:03:00
UI / UX Design 00:09:00
Social Media Icons 00:08:00
External CSS Style adding 00:06:00
Coding Exercise 00:01:00
Solution for Coding Exercise 00:03:00
Summary 00:02:00
CSS Website Project
Introduction 00:01:00
CSS Project Getting 00:05:00
CSS Project Overview 00:08:00
Summary 00:01:00
JavaScript Getting Started
What is JavaScript 00:09:00
Installing Code Editor(Sublime Text) 00:04:00
Installing Code Editor(Visual Studio Code) 00:07:00
Hello World Program 00:14:00
Getting Output 00:11:00
Summary 00:02:00
JavaScript Fundamentals
Introduction 00:02:00
Internal JavaScript 00:13:00
External JavaScript 00:09:00
Inline JavaScript 00:04:00
Async and defer 00:06:00
Variables 00:13:00
Data Types 00:10:00
Numbers 00:06:00
Boolean 00:04:00
Arrays() 00:12:00
Objects 00:06:00
Comments 00:05:00
Summary 00:01:00
Strings
Introduction 00:02:00
Strings 00:06:00
String Formatting 00:05:00
String Methods 00:12:00
Summary 00:02:00
Operators
Introduction 00:02:00
Arithmetic operators 00:07:00
Assignment operators 00:03:00
Comparison operators 00:06:00
Logical operators 00:08:00
Summary 00:02:00
Conditional Statements
Introduction 00:02:00
If statement 00:04:00
If-else statement 00:05:00
If-else-if statement 00:04:00
Switch-case statement 00:09:00
Summary 00:01:00
Control Flow Statements
Introduction 00:02:00
While loop 00:09:00
Do-while loop 00:03:00
For loop 00:08:00
Break 00:02:00
Continue 00:03:00
Coding Exercise 00:02:00
Solution for Coding Exercise 00:02:00
Summary 00:02:00
Functions
Introduction 00:02:00
Creating a Function 00:07:00
Function Call() 00:07:00
Function with parameters 00:05:00
Function Bind() 00:06:00
Summary 00:01:00
Data Visualization(Google Chats)
Introduction 00:01:00
How to Use Google chart script 00:04:00
Line Graph chart 00:14:00
Scatter plots chart 00:02:00
Bar chart 00:04:00
Pie chart 00:02:00
3D Pie chart 00:02:00
Summary 00:01:00
Error Handling
Introduction 00:01:00
Try-catch 00:05:00
Try-catch-finally 00:17:00
Summary 00:01:00
Client-side Validations
Introduction 00:11:00
On Submit Validation 00:09:00
Input Numeric Validation 00:12:00
Login Form Validation 00:05:00
Password Strength Check Validation 00:04:00
Summary 00:01:00
Publish Your Website for Live
Introduction 00:02:00
Installing Free FTP Solution (FileZilla) 00:04:00
Setting Up FTP (File Transfer Protocol) 00:03:00
Publish Website to Hosting Server 00:04:00
Summary 00:01:00
Order Your Certificate
Order Your Certificate 00:00:00
Order Your QLS Certificate
Order Your QLS Certificate 00:00:00

Related Courses

A product of

© 2026 NextGen Learning. All rights reserved

Home Search Cart Offers
Select your currency
GBP Pound sterling